Biyamiti young males seen on H1-1/H3 junction :

Photo Credits : Gert De Koker


*This image is copyright of its original author


First male was seen mating with 2 lionesses a week ago:





Those 2 might be the same lionesses with who are this 2 unknown males seen mating in that area in the past weeks :

Photo Credits : Barry Christensen


*This image is copyright of its original author


This 2 are seen quite often there and i posted quite a few photos of them already.. 

I will call them Mathekenyane males (from the hill top near by), some people think they are Charlestons (Mazino's) sons:

Older male :

Photo Credits : karenjbay

*This image is copyright of its original author


Younger male:

Photo Credits : Kruger Sightings 

*This image is copyright of its original author


From the reports it looks like that Mathekenyane males and Biyamiti young males are in competition for the same females as they where seen in the same spot just day apart and mating with 2 females in the same area in the past weeks..

Also, near them, just further west on H1-1 near Transport Dam, this 2 where seen:

https://m.facebook.com/groups/1998834171...806711713/

Those are this 2 seen on Kruger Sightings on H1-1 :


*This image is copyright of its original author


Those are not H2-2 males, those are 2 new males on H1-1 around Shitlhave and Transport Dams, there was reports of 2 new males around Shitlhave Dam and some takeovers.. 

Hope we can see more better pictures of this 2 to see who they might be..
